Health checks for services behind the Gatewarden balancer are rate-limited per backend, and plugin-registered endpoints share that budget. If your plugin adds a custom probe, it must respond within the global deadline or the backend is marked draining — there is no per-plugin override. Failure counting is consecutive, not windowed. The limits your probes must operate within are defined by the constants below.

limits module of fajog-kahag:
QUOTAS = {
    "druael": 1,
    "zorath": 10,
    "druath": 1,
    "druwyn": 5,
}

Ticket: Crashfall ingest failing on staging

New folks, please read carefully. The Pebblekit mobile app's crash reports aren't reaching the symbolication queue because staging's env file was copied without its upload credential. Symptoms: 401s in the collector logs every five minutes. To fix, add the missing line to the env file, exactly as follows.

secret setting of fafop-tagep: VAULT_KEY29=6a815d21e2d77cc25ef1802d73ee6

## Releases

Hey support folks — quick notes on ProfileMesh shard releases. Each release re-balances user-profile shards gradually, so don't panic if a lookup lands on a stale shard for a few minutes post-deploy; it self-heals. Release bundles are published twice a month and are always signed. If a customer asks you to verify a bundle they downloaded, walk them through the checksum step using the public signing key below.

deploy key for kawif-bageg: bky19_YQNdHDgpaLxUNwPoHm9

Ticket: Unlock migration vault for Ironvine ORM refactor

New team members: the legacy Ironvine ORM layer is being replaced module by module, and the schema snapshots needed for safe refactoring sit in a locked vault nobody has opened since the last owner left. We recovered the credentials from escrow this week. The passphrase follows below.

unlock words, kajog-yawip: istwyn-casath-aldok